Understand the Basics: Begin by familiarizing yourself with the fundamental concepts of web development. Learn about HTML (Hypertext Markup Language) for creating the structure of web pages and CSS (Cascading Style Sheets) for styling those pages. These are the building blocks of web development.
Learn Programming Languages: You'll need to learn programming languages to add interactivity and functionality to your websites. The two main languages are:
JavaScript: This is a must-know language for front-end and even back-end development (using technologies like Node.js). It's used for creating dynamic and interactive web content. Back-End Language: To handle server-side tasks like database management and server communication, you'll need to learn a back-end language. Popular options include Python (Django, Flask), Ruby (Ruby on Rails), PHP, Java, and Node.js. Front-End Development: Focus on front-end development if you're interested in designing and creating the user interface of websites. Learn about frameworks like:
React: A popular JavaScript library for building user interfaces. Angular: A comprehensive front-end framework developed by Google. Vue.js: A progressive JavaScript framework for building interactive web interfaces. Back-End Development: If you're interested in server-side logic, databases, and managing data, delve into back-end development. Familiarize yourself with concepts like server-side scripting, databases (SQL or NoSQL), and API development.
Database Management: Learn about databases and how to interact with them. Common databases used in web development include MySQL, PostgreSQL, MongoDB, and Firebase.
Version Control: Git is a vital tool for collaborating with others and keeping track of your code changes. Learn how to use Git and platforms like GitHub or GitLab.
Responsive Design: Study responsive design principles to ensure your websites look and function well on various devices and screen sizes.
Web Development Tools: Familiarize yourself with development tools such as code editors (VS Code, Sublime Text), browser developer tools, and debugging techniques.
Learn Web Development Frameworks: Frameworks can expedite development by providing pre-built components and structures. Some examples include Express.js (for Node.js back-end development) and Django (for Python back-end development).
Practice and Build Projects: Practical experience is crucial. Start by building small projects and gradually work your way up to more complex ones. Building a portfolio of projects showcases your skills to potential employers or clients.
Continuous Learning: The field of web development is constantly evolving. Stay up-to-date with new technologies, trends, and best practices by reading blogs, attending conferences, and taking online courses.
Networking: Join online developer communities, attend meetups, and engage with fellow developers.
